Output 188d5c6059d56b143de72f4a279808a24695302c592b7efddbd4120a611ce655:8

value
1805823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cb406ae32ec9277e4d9f11351a3a52210c673e4 OP_EQUALVERIFY OP_CHECKSIG
address
1M7yKdqUaD7838AMz57txbDaEtPkPVVBdR
transaction
188d5c6059d56b143de72f4a279808a24695302c592b7efddbd4120a611ce655
spent
true